    Now as a Canadian turking for about 4 months on and off, I have to say, it doesn't seem as practical as the kind of work US turkers are getting. This can be most easily evidenced by simply looking through the HITS posted on the daily threads. A huge majority of them are only available to US turkers. I've tried searching on this forum, the subreddit and other turk communities for any Canadian turkers that could have tips, but the stuff I found was old or the tips were vague and not very helpful.

    Mainly, I'm curious to know if any Canadian turkers browse this forum and if you think it's worth it despite the lower amount of work we get. I'd like to know if it's a solid side gig for you and if you'd recommend sticking to it!

    I'm fairly certain that most of us here are US turkers. Honestly the main issue I would have as a non US worker is not the whole lack of work thing but the fact that you aren't able to send the money you earn directly to your bank account unless you are a US worker.
